Anlık mesajlaşma uygulamaları artık yalnızca iletişim aracı değil; topluluk yönetimi, medya paylaşımı ve hatta dijital güvenlik platformları haline geldi. Bu dönüşümün en dikkat çekici örneklerinden biri, gizlilik ve hız odaklı yapısıyla öne çıkan Telegram’dır.
Kullanıcılarına uçtan uca şifreleme, devasa grup sohbetleri, bot entegrasyonları ve bulut senkronizasyonu gibi özellikler sunan Telegram, modern iletişimde yeni bir standart oluşturmuştur.
Eğer siz de Telegram gibi bir mobil uygulama geliştirmek istiyorsanız, güçlü bir altyapı, yüksek güvenlik protokolleri, API tabanlı mimari ve ölçeklenebilir sunucu yapısına sahip olmanız gerekir.

Telegram’ın İş Modeli ve Başarı Sırları
Telegram doğrudan reklam veya ücretli üyelikten değil, hız, güvenlik ve özgürlük temelli kullanıcı bağlılığından güç alır.
Son dönemde premium üyelik (Telegram Premium) ile ikinci bir gelir modeli oluşturmuştur.
Temel yapı taşları şunlardır:
-
Freemium model: Ücretsiz kullanım + Premium özellikler (büyük dosya yükleme, özel emoji, hız avantajı).
-
Topluluk Odaklı Yapı: Açık API ve bot desteğiyle geliştirici ekosistemi büyütür.
-
Güvenlik & Gizlilik: MTProto protokolü ile veri şifreleme ve gizli sohbet.
Temel Özellikler
1. Kullanıcı Uygulaması
-
Telefon numarası / e-posta ile kayıt
-
Kişi senkronizasyonu (rehber erişimi)
-
Uçtan uca şifreli mesajlaşma
-
Sesli ve görüntülü arama
-
Grup sohbetleri (200.000 kişiye kadar)
-
Kanal oluşturma (tek yönlü yayınlar)
-
Bot desteği (AI, otomatik yanıt, ödeme, oyun vb.)
-
Medya paylaşımı (fotoğraf, video, belge, ses, konum, sticker, GIF)
-
Mesaj düzenleme, silme, sabitleme
-
Gizli sohbet (self-destruct, ekran görüntüsü koruması)
-
Bulut senkronizasyonu (mesaj geçmişi yedekleme)
-
Çoklu cihaz desteği (telefon, tablet, masaüstü senkron)
2. Yönetici Paneli
-
Kullanıcı yönetimi ve moderasyon araçları
-
Kanal & grup yönetimi (üye sayısı, istatistik, yetkilendirme)
-
Bot API anahtar yönetimi
-
Dosya, mesaj, medya denetimi
-
Spam ve kötüye kullanım raporlama sistemi
-
Gerçek zamanlı istatistikler (mesaj trafiği, aktif kullanıcı, depolama kullanımı)
Teknik Gereksinimler
Mobil
-
Framework: Flutter (tek kod tabanı iOS & Android için)
-
Gerçek Zamanlı İletişim: WebSocket, MQTT veya GRPC
-
Veri Şifreleme: AES-256, RSA-2048, Diffie-Hellman anahtar değişimi
-
Push Bildirim: Firebase Cloud Messaging / APNs
-
Medya Sıkıştırma: OpenCV / FFmpeg
Backend
-
Dil & Framework: Node.js / Go / Elixir (yüksek eşzamanlı bağlantılar için)
-
Veritabanı: PostgreSQL + Redis (cache + oturum yönetimi)
-
Mesaj Kuyruğu: RabbitMQ / Kafka
-
Depolama: AWS S3 / MinIO (dosya yükleme ve CDN dağıtımı)
-
Sunucu: Mikro servis mimarisi + yük dengeleme (Nginx, HAProxy)
-
API: REST + WebSocket API (açık geliştirici erişimi)
-
Güvenlik: JWT token, OAuth 2.0, SSL, KVKK uyumlu veri yönetimi
Güvenlik ve Gizlilik
Telegram benzeri bir uygulamada güvenlik en kritik unsurdur:
-
MTProto veya eşdeğer şifreleme protokolü: Tüm mesaj trafiğini şifreler.
-
Uçtan uca şifreleme: Sadece gönderen ve alıcı mesajı okuyabilir.
-
Kendini imha eden mesajlar: Belirli süre sonunda otomatik silinir.
-
Sunucu tarafı anonimleştirme: Kullanıcı verileri ayrıştırılmış şekilde saklanır.
-
İki Aşamalı Doğrulama (2FA): Hesap güvenliği artırılır.
Gelişmiş Özellikler
-
Bot Platformu:
-
Geliştiriciler için açık API
-
Otomatik yanıt, müşteri hizmeti, oyun, ödeme botları
-
-
Kanal & Topluluk Yönetimi:
-
Binlerce üye, sınırsız gönderi
-
Gelişmiş moderasyon (yönetici atama, izin kontrolü)
-
-
Dosya Paylaşımı:
-
2 GB’a kadar dosya gönderimi
-
Bulut tabanlı dosya depolama
-
-
Temalar & Karanlık Mod:
-
Kullanıcı arayüzü özelleştirme
-
-
Çoklu Dil Desteği:
-
Uluslararası kullanım için JSON tabanlı dil dosyaları
-
Gelir Modelleri
-
Freemium & Premium: Ücretsiz kullanım, ücretli ek özellikler (yüksek hız, özel sticker, büyük dosya limiti).
-
Bot Market: Ücretli bot lisansları veya komisyon bazlı model.
-
Reklam Alanı: Kanal içi minimal reklamlar.
-
Kurumsal Lisanslama: Özel mesajlaşma altyapısı isteyen şirketlere SaaS çözümü.
Maliyet Kalemleri
-
Mobil uygulama geliştirme (iOS & Android)
-
Backend altyapısı ve gerçek zamanlı sunucu (yüksek trafik destekli)
-
Şifreleme sistemleri (DRM, sertifika yönetimi)
-
Depolama ve CDN maliyetleri
-
UI/UX tasarımı ve kullanıcı deneyimi testleri
-
Pazarlama ve topluluk yönetimi giderleri
Operasyonel Süreçler
-
Kullanıcı Onboarding: Numara doğrulama, gizlilik politikası onayı
-
Mesajlaşma Testleri: Eşzamanlı kullanıcı trafiği, veri kaybı testleri
-
Spam & Abuse Kontrol: AI destekli kötüye kullanım tespiti
-
Sunucu Ölçeklendirme: Trafik artışına göre otomatik kaynak yönetimi
-
Destek & Geri Bildirim: Çoklu kanal destek sistemi (bot + e-posta + panel)
Neden SM Mobil?
Telegram gibi bir mobil uygulama geliştirmek, sıradan bir sohbet uygulamasından çok daha fazlasını gerektirir. Gerçek zamanlı iletişim, veri gizliliği, bulut mimarisi ve güvenli şifreleme sistemlerini tek çatı altında toplamak gerekir.
SM Mobil olarak, uçtan uca şifreleme destekli mesajlaşma uygulamaları geliştiriyoruz.
Flutter tabanlı çoklu platform desteği, WebSocket mimarisi, AES/RSA şifreleme altyapısı ve bot API entegrasyonu ile projenizi ölçeklenebilir, güvenli ve modern hale getiriyoruz.
Gerçek zamanlı testlerden, yüksek trafikli altyapı kurulumuna kadar tüm süreçleri sizin için yönetiyoruz.
Daha fazla bilgi için mobiluygulamagelistirme.tr adresimizi ziyaret edebilir

